The explorer and friend of the poet John Donne you are referring to is Sir Walter Raleigh. He was indeed an adventurer, a favorite courtier of Queen Elizabeth I, a devout Protestant, and a privateer against Spanish fleets.

As an individual of significant influence during the Elizabethan age, Sir Walter Raleigh is best remembered for his attempts to colonize the New World, including his efforts to establish the Roanoke Colony.

In the realm of literature and poetry, however, he was connected to Donne and other poets of the time who were deeply engaged in the cultural and intellectual discourse of their era.
